#!/usr/bin/env python
# coding=utf-8
from __future__ import unicode_literals
import math
from test.constants import RANGE_COLOR
from nose.tools import eq_
from pyecharts import Surface3D
def create_surface3d_data():
for t0 in range(-30, 30, 1):
y = t0 / 10
for t1 in range(-30, 30, 1):
x = t1 / 10
z = math.sin(x * x + y * y) * x / 3.14
yield [x, y, z]
def test_surface3d_default():
_data = list(create_surface3d_data())
surface3d = Surface3D("3D 曲面图示例", width=1200, height=600)
surface3d.add(
"",
_data,
is_visualmap=True,
visual_range_color=RANGE_COLOR,
visual_range=[-3, 3],
grid3d_rotate_sensitivity=5,
)
assert "lambert" not in surface3d._repr_html_()
def test_surface3d_must_use_canvas():
surface3d = Surface3D()
eq_(surface3d.renderer, "canvas")
